GEORGE FREDERICK BERGMAN, 71, of Rowland Ave., life-long Mansfield resident, died at General Hospital Tuesday following an illness of several days.

Mr. Bergman was born in Mansfield January 25, 1893. For many years he was employed as bookkeeper and auditor by the Tracy and Avery Co., and in more recent years at the W. E. Jones Piano and Furniture House, retiring from the latter company in 1963.

Mr. Bergman was a member of St. John's United Church of Christ, Venus Lodge 152, F and AM; Council 94, R and S.M.; Chapter 28, R. A. M.; and the Ancient and Accepted Scottish Rite, Canton Consistory. He was treasurer of the North Lake Park Assn.

Surviving are his wife, Mrs. Emma Thomas Bergman; a son, Harry Bergman of Ft. Wayne, IN; a daughter, Mrs. William Rowe of Elyria; two grandsons and two granddaughters; one brother, Albert Bergman of Mansfield. Two brothers, Karl and William Bergman, preceded him in death.

Masonic memorial services will be conducted this evening at the Jones Memorial. Funeral services will be conducted Friday in the Jones Memorial. Burial in the Memorial Park.

~News Journal (Mansfield, OH)
Weds., 25 Nov 1964, pg. 11
